129. Bowl with Collar3D Model
Description: Bowl has a high collar and inside shoulder that may have supported a lid. The bowl has an S-shaped profile beginning with the inside shoulder, tracing the steep slope of the side and terminating above the pad base. In the center of the pad base is a semicircular indentation that appears as a small dome on the inside of the bowl surrounded by a narrow trough. The rim of the collar is rounded; the lower edge of the collar is flattened.
Date: 1st century BC – 1st century AD
Measurements (cm): H: 6.7 W: 12.4
